    Garage utility sink

    If you go with the plastic laundry type sink, get one from that offers a wall mount option. I've found the included legs to be flimsy and easy to bump and move.

    ShopVac for the house? Alternatives for hard floor vacuuming?

    Cordless Dyson are convenient but nothing beats a corded Miele setup. Not inexpensive but built to last with replaceable components in good supply. The basic S1 is a workhorse and shares the same attachments as my Fein dust extractor which is a plus...

    Plumbing with pex

    Propex is fine for DIY if you have access to all the correct piping, rings and fittings. The manual expander is easy to use if you have the space to use it, during rough-in for example. Milwaukee’s M12 is the best bet if space is tight. Supplyhouse.com is an excellent source for Uponor’s propex...
